numpy.trim_zeros #
- 麻木的。修剪_零(filt,修剪= 'fb')[来源] #
修剪一维数组或序列中的前导和/或尾随零。
- 参数:
- 过滤一维数组或序列
输入数组。
- 修剪str,可选
一个字符串,其中“f”表示从前面修剪,“b”表示从后面修剪。默认为“fb”,从数组的前面和后面修剪零。
- 返回:
- 修剪后的一维数组或序列
修剪输入的结果。输入数据类型被保留。
例子
>>> a = np.array((0, 0, 0, 1, 2, 3, 0, 2, 1, 0)) >>> np.trim_zeros(a) array([1, 2, 3, 0, 2, 1])
>>> np.trim_zeros(a, 'b') array([0, 0, 0, ..., 0, 2, 1])
输入数据类型被保留,列表/元组输入意味着列表/元组输出。
>>> np.trim_zeros([0, 1, 2, 0]) [1, 2]